(Washington, D.C) U.S. Congressman Sam Graves announced that the Department of Education has awarded a $979,621 grant to the Blue Springs School District R-IV. The funds will be used to participate in the Teaching American History Grants Program
.
“In order to define our future, it is essential for our children to know our past,” said Graves. “The Teaching American History Grants Program will help ensure that our teachers are experts on American History.”
The program is designed to raise student achievement by improving teachers' knowledge and understanding of and appreciation for traditional U.S. history. By helping teachers to develop a deeper understanding and appreciation of U.S. history as a separate subject matter within the core curriculum, these programs will improve instruction and raise student achievement.
